Standard Measurements for Residential Units
For home installations, the standard pull up bar height is generally measured from the floor to the top of the bar, sitting comfortably within the range of 80 to 86 inches (approximately 203 to 218 cm). This specific range is engineered to accommodate the average adult male, who typically stands between 5'9" and 5'11" tall. Within this standard, the optimal height usually lands around 84 inches (213 cm), allowing users to achieve a full dead hang with straight arms while their feet remain clear of the ground.

Adjustability for Diverse Users
Recognizing that not everyone fits the average demographic, modern pull up bars are designed with significant adjustability in mind. For younger users or those new to calisthenics, the standard pull up bar height might need to be lowered. This adjustment reduces the intensity of the movement, allowing beginners to focus on pulling mechanics and building foundational strength without the complexity of a full range of motion. Conversely, taller individuals may require a higher mounting point to prevent knee or foot friction during kipping swings, ensuring the movement remains smooth and unrestricted.

Impact on Technique and Progression
Maintaining the correct standard pull up bar height is not just about comfort; it is integral to mastering advanced techniques. Proper form requires a full dead hang where your shoulders are engaged and your scapulae are stabilized. If the bar height forces you to bend your knees excessively or swing your legs to initiate the movement, you are compromising the integrity of the exercise. Correct height ensures that the primary effort is directed by the back and arm muscles, which is essential for progressing toward unassisted pull-ups and muscle-ups.

Common Mistakes to Avoid
One of the most frequent errors individuals make is installing the bar too low to avoid the initial difficulty of the hang. This creates a false sense of achievement while neglecting the critical eccentric phase of the movement where the lats are stretched and strengthened. Another mistake is setting the bar so high that the user struggles to get their chin over it, leading to excessive kipping and hyperextension of the spine. Finding the sweet spot requires a trial-and-error approach where the user can perform strict reps with controlled tempo.
